为制备具有抗菌斑和抗胶原酶特性的引导牙周组织再生(GTR)胶原膜,作者将普通交联胶原膜用四环素(TC)缓释装置包被,制成双抗胶原膜(BACM)。检测结果:BACM具均匀小网孔;低应变区弹性模量和膨胀率分别为204g/mm2和0141;豚鼠过敏试验阴性;抗100u胶原酶消化时达30d以上;1mgBACM植入小鼠皮下可维持7w左右;BACM(含TC150μg)置入牙周袋内7d,龈沟液TC浓度维持在4676μmol/L±5.69μmol/L;植入翻瓣术患者根面7d,其上附着菌明显少于对照膜。结果提示具有双抗效应的BACM用于GTR将发挥更好的作用。
This study was undertaken to assess the antiplaque and anticollagenase properties of bianticollagen membrane (BACM) for use in the guided tissue regeneration (GTR). First, Preparaing crosslinked collagen membrane (GLCM) from bone collagen by glutaraldehyde and ultraviolet irradiation. Then, the GLCM was coated with tetracycline (TC) delivery device, which is BACM. BACM's properties are as follows: under scan electron microscope (SEM), it is a three dimensional structure with small pores; the modulus of elasticity in low strain regions and swelling ratio are 20.4 g/mm2 and 0.141 respectively; immediate type and delayed type hypersensitivity are negative; BACM with TC 150 μg placed into pockets, the average intrasulcular TC concentration measured at the end of the 7days is 46.76±5.69 μmol/L, Which is 2 times higher than MIC of TC; the period against collagenase (100u) digestion is over 30 days in vitro; 1 mg GLCM and BACM implanted in mice may maintain about 4 weeks and 7 weeks respectively, and BACM and GLCM placed onto patient′s root surface in flap operation and taken at 7th day the bacteria on BACM are significantly less than that on GLCM under SEM. These results indicate that BACM has antiplaque and stronger antidegradation effects than GLCM.
